The Role of Protein in Muscle Growing and Repair
Protein is often associated with muscle growth and repair
and for good reason. You create micro-tears in your muscle fibers when you
engage in physical activities such as strength training or endurance exercises.
Protein delivers the necessary building blocks, amino acids, to repair and
rebuild these damaged muscle fibers, leading to muscle growth and adaptation.
To optimize muscle growth, consuming an adequate amount of
protein is essential. The recommended daily protein intake for individuals
engaged in regular exercise is approximately 0.8 to 1 gram of protein per kg of
body weightiness. However, for those aiming to build muscle or recover from
intense workouts, a higher protein intake of around 1.2 to 2 grams per kilogram
of body weight may be beneficial.
Complete vs. Incomplete Proteins
Protein sources can be categorized as complete or incomplete
based on their amino acid profile. Complete proteins contain all nine essential
amino acids that the body cannot produce on its own, while incomplete proteins
lack one or more of these essential amino acids.
Animal-based protein sources such as meat, fowl, fish, eggs,
and dairy products are complete proteins. They provide a rich and balanced
array of amino acids for muscle growth and repair. Plant-based protein sources,
on the other hand, often lack one or more essential amino acids. However, individuals
can obtain a complete amino acid profile by combining different plant-based
protein sources, such as legumes and grains.
Timing and Distribution of Protein Intake
While meeting your daily protein requirements is essential,
the timing and delivery of protein intake throughout the day can also impact
your fitness goals. Research suggests that distributing protein evenly across
meals, rather than consuming a large amount in a single sitting, may be more
beneficial for muscle protein synthesis.
To optimize muscle protein synthesis, aim to consume 20 to
30 grams of high-quality protein per meal. This can be achieved by
incorporating protein-rich foods such as lean meats, poultry, fish, eggs, dairy
products, legumes, and plant-based proteins into each meal.
Additionally, consuming protein shortly after a workout is
often recommended. This post-workout window is critical for your muscles to be
primed for nutrient uptake and recovery. Consuming a protein source within 30
to 60 minutes after exercise can help promote muscle repair and growth.
Supplementing with Protein Powders
Protein powders have become a convenient way to increase
protein intake, especially for individuals with higher protein needs or those
seeking quick and easy post-workout nutrition. Protein powders come in various
forms, counting whey protein, casein protein, soy protein, and plant-based
protein powders.
Whey protein, resulting from milk, is one of the most
commonly used protein powders due to its high biological value and rapid
absorption. Casein protein, also derived from milk, is slower-digesting and can
sustain amino acid release to the muscles. Plant-based protein powders, such as
pea, rice, and hemp protein, offer options for individuals following vegetarian
or vegan diets.
While protein powders can be a convenient supplement, it is essential
to remember that they should not replace whole-food protein sources. They
should be used to supplement a well-balanced diet and meet your individual
protein needs.
Protein Myths and Misconceptions
There are several myths and misconceptions surrounding
protein and its impact on fitness. One common misconception is that excessive
protein will automatically increase muscle mass. In reality, the body is
limited to how much protein it can utilize for muscle growth, and exceeding
that limit does not provide additional benefits.
Another myth is that a high-protein diet can harm kidney
function. While individuals with pre-existing kidney conditions should consult their
healthcare professionals, numerous studies have shown that a high-protein diet
does not risk healthy kidneys.
Additionally, some believe only animal-based protein sources
are practical for muscle growth. When appropriately combined, plant-based
protein sources can offer all the amino acids necessary for muscle protein
synthesis.
